An apparatus which develops an electrostatic latent image recorded on a photoconductive member with developer material of carrier granules and toner particles. A housing has a developing chamber and a mixing chamber. As toner particles are depleted during the printing process, additional toner particles are furnished to the mixing chamber. A mixing roller is located in the mixing chamber. An arcuate portion of the housing is closely adjacent to the mixing roller. An electrical bias is formed between the arcuate portion of the housing and the mixing roller. Toner particles charged to one polarity are attracted to the arcuate portion of the housing with toner particles charged to the opposite polarity being attracted to the mixing roller. As the mixing roller rotates, developer material is advanced to a receiving zone. The advancing developer material moves the toner particles attracted to the arcuate portion of the housing to the receiving zone. At the receiving zone, an auger transports the developer material to a loading zone where the developer material is received by another auger in the developing chamber. The auger in the developing chamber advances the developer material to a transport roll, which, in turn, moves the developer material to a developer roll. The developer roll transports the developer material closely adjacent to the photoconductive member having the electrostatic latent image recorded thereon. The latent image attracts toner particles thereto so as to be developed thereby.
